Alcohol + oxygen → carbon dioxide + water
Complete combustion of alcohols to produce carbon dioxide and water
Substitution of alcohols to produce halogenoalkanes
Alcohol + sodium → sodium alkoxide + hydrogen
Alcohols react with Na to form a basic sodium alkoxide salt and hydrogen gas

Oxidation of ethanol by acidified K2Cr2O7 to form an aldehyde by distillation and carboxylic acid by refluxing

Oxidation of propan-2-ol by acidified K2Cr2O7?to form a ketone by distillation

Dehydration of ethanol using aluminium oxide as a catalyst forms ethene gas, which can be collected over water
Carboxylic acid + alcohol → ester + water
Esterification of ethanol and ethanoic acid using a strong acid catalyst to form ethyl ethanoate and water
The first part of an ester’s name comes from the alcohol, whereas the second part comes from the carboxylic acid.So, if ethanol and propanoic acid react together, this will make the ester?ethyl propanoate.
